A book that takes you behind the scenes of filmmaking which has been done before, but this one feels unique and fresh. Kate Morgan decides to take the biggest risk and leave her family in San Francisco to follow her grandfather's words to go find the beautiful stranger; these words take her to the Hotel del Coronado and in the middle of a film set.

I will always love books that take you behind the scenes of any profession, but something gets me about reading about being on a film set. Of course, a film set that has Marilyn Monroe on it makes it even more special and reading (yes fiction) about how she was on set and how the public and her cast and crew reacted to her was so fascinating. It made it feel even more special that it was a famous actress that we were following behind the scenes.
